IN NO EVENT SHALL THE AUTHOR OR CONTRIBUTORS BE LIABLE 24 * FOR ANY DIRECT, INDIRECT, INCIDENTAL, SPECIAL, EXEMPLARY, OR CONSEQUENTIAL 25 * DAMAGES (INCLUDING, BUT NOT LIMITED TO, PROCUREMENT OF SUBSTITUTE GOODS 26 * OR SERVICES; LOSS OF USE, DATA, OR PROFITS; OR BUSINESS INTERRUPTION) 27 * HOWEVER CAUSED AND ON ANY THEORY OF LIABILITY, WHETHER IN CONTRACT, STRICT 28 * LIABILITY, OR TORT (INCLUDING NEGLIGENCE OR OTHERWISE) ARISING IN ANY WAY 29 * OUT OF THE USE OF THIS SOFTWARE, EVEN IF ADVISED OF THE POSSIBILITY OF 30 * SUCH DAMAGE. 31 * 32 * $FreeBSD: head/lib/libkse/thread/thr_once.c 156611 2006-03-13 00:59:51Z deischen $ 33 */ 34#include "namespace.h" 35#include <pthread.h> 36#include "un-namespace.h" 37#include "thr_private.h" 38 39LT10_COMPAT_PRIVATE(_pthread_once); 40LT10_COMPAT_DEFAULT(pthread_once); 41 42__weak_reference(_pthread_once, pthread_once); 43 44#define ONCE_NEVER_DONE PTHREAD_NEEDS_INIT 45#define ONCE_DONE PTHREAD_DONE_INIT 46#define ONCE_IN_PROGRESS 0x02 47#define ONCE_MASK 0x03 48 49static pthread_mutex_t once_lock = PTHREAD_MUTEX_INITIALIZER; 50static pthread_cond_t once_cv = PTHREAD_COND_INITIALIZER; 51 52/* 53 * POSIX: 54 * The pthread_once() function is not a cancellation point. However, 55 * if init_routine is a cancellation point and is canceled, the effect 56 * on once_control shall be as if pthread_once() was never called. 57 */ 58 59static void 60once_cancel_handler(void *arg) 61{ 62 pthread_once_t *once_control = arg; 63 64 _pthread_mutex_lock(&once_lock); 65 once_control->state = ONCE_NEVER_DONE; 66 _pthread_mutex_unlock(&once_lock); 67 _pthread_cond_broadcast(&once_cv); 68} 69 70int 71_pthread_once(pthread_once_t *once_control, void (*init_routine) (void)) 72{ 73 struct pthread *curthread; 74 int wakeup = 0; 75 76 if (once_control->state == ONCE_DONE) 77 return (0); 78 _pthread_mutex_lock(&once_lock); 79 while (*(volatile int *)&(once_control->state) == ONCE_IN_PROGRESS) 80 _pthread_cond_wait(&once_cv, &once_lock); 81 /* 82 * If previous thread was canceled, then the state still 83 * could be ONCE_NEVER_DONE, we need to check it again. 84 */ 85 if (*(volatile int *)&(once_control->state) == ONCE_NEVER_DONE) { 86 once_control->state = ONCE_IN_PROGRESS; 87 _pthread_mutex_unlock(&once_lock); 88 curthread = _get_curthread(); 89 THR_CLEANUP_PUSH(curthread, once_cancel_handler, once_control); 90 init_routine(); 91 THR_CLEANUP_POP(curthread, 0); 92 _pthread_mutex_lock(&once_lock); 93 once_control->state = ONCE_DONE; 94 wakeup = 1; 95 } 96 _pthread_mutex_unlock(&once_lock); 97 if (wakeup) 98 _pthread_cond_broadcast(&once_cv); 99 return (0); 100} 101 102
